Output efebea0959a03cf4cc29e5ec930fceda491caaa4177419860bc99797cf75382d:0

value
130611
script pubkey
OP_0 OP_PUSHBYTES_20 7248f5ec056ad30625bad6204cedc4fa09fddc32
address
bc1qwfy0tmq9dtfsvfd66csyemwylgylmhpjuk0qds
transaction
efebea0959a03cf4cc29e5ec930fceda491caaa4177419860bc99797cf75382d
confirmations
34848
spent
true